Preview Sitges 2014: «The Midnight After» by Fruit Chan

The Midnight After

Asian cinema is always very present in the Sitges Festival, especially in the Focus Asia section, although there is also an oriental representation in the official section.

Fruit Chan's new work "The Midnight After" is one of these Asian films, specifically produced in Hong Kong, that this year the Focus Asia section is too small and becomes part of the official section.

Known for films like «Three… Extremes«, In which he joined Park Chan-wook and Takashi Miike, two old acquaintances of the Catalan contest, to carry out an episode film, or«Dumplings«, A film in which he extended the story of his fragment of« Three… Extremes », Fruit Chan He is now arriving at the International Fantastic Film Festival of Catalonia with a film with apocalyptic airs.

«The Midnight After»Tells how 17 people on board a minibus realize when they come out of a tunnel that everyone has disappeared. From there they have to rethink their lives in order to survive, facing a strange virus, while they are chased by a masked man.
